## Onboarding: Bounce Processor (Mallowline)

As release manager, you own deploys of Mallowline, our email bounce processor. It drains the bounce queue, classifies failures, and suppresses dead addresses. Releases require the sealed signing identity; the duty operator normally unlocks it. If the operator is unreachable during a release window, you may unseal it yourself using the recovery passphrase recorded on the line below.

unlock words, kagef-taduf: fenir-quenix-norwyn-sorvan-gormir-gorir-fraok

Handover Note — Velsmoor Expansion

From the outgoing director to the incoming: the Velsmoor expansion is at the site-selection stage, with two premises shortlisted and lease talks underway. Branch managers should hold recruitment until leases are signed. Budget approval is in place through the first fit-out phase. The confidential note on business plans follows below this handover.

board note of yagaf-yawig: Project Gorvan slips by one quarter because of the staffing delay.

Ticket: Staging env misconfigured for Siftgate bloom filter

The bloom layer in front of the Pellet KV store is rejecting all lookups in staging because the env file was copied from the dev template without credentials. False-positive tuning values are fine; only the auth line is missing. To unblock the weekly demo, the Pellet admission secret must be set on the following line.

env line for yaguf-fajop: LEDGER_TOKEN13=fb08984397349

**Ceremony checklist — step 9: Fanline backpressure keys**

Confirm the Fanline notification fan-out service is in drain mode and backpressure thresholds are frozen before key rotation begins. The Orvandel release manager signs off once queue depth reads zero for five consecutive minutes. After both custodians insert their tokens and the new key is sealed, record the escrow recovery passphrase directly beneath this item.

vault phrase of kawep-tahog = ulaix-briath